The Power of Shared Stories: Humans of NY Tackles Wellness and Abuse
Humans of New York (HONY) has captivated millions with its poignant portraits and raw, honest stories from everyday people. Founded by photographer Brandon Stanton in 2010, this photoblog has evolved into a global phenomenon, shedding light on the diverse experiences that shape our shared humanity. Recently, HONY has delved into the critical topics of wellness and abuse, offering a platform for survivors to share their journeys of healing and resilience.
Voices of Survival: Breaking the Silence on Abuse
HONY’s exploration of abuse stories has given voice to those who have long suffered in silence. These narratives, while often heart-wrenching, serve a vital purpose in raising awareness and fostering empathy. By sharing these experiences, HONY contributes to breaking down the stigma surrounding abuse and encourages others to seek help and support.
One particularly moving story featured a woman who survived years of domestic violence. She recounted her journey from fear and isolation to finding the strength to leave her abuser and rebuild her life. Her words resonated with many readers, sparking conversations about the importance of support systems and the courage it takes to start anew.
